Tajikistan and ADB signed a grant agreement to reconnect country to the Central Asian energy system
DUSHANBE, 27.11.2018. /NIAT “Khovar”/. The grant agreement between the Government of the Republic of Tajikistan and the Asian Development Bank on the project to reconnect the Republic of Tajikistan to the Central Asian energy system in the amount of $ 35 million was signed in Dushanbe, the press service of the Ministry of Economic Development and Trade of Tajikistan reports.
“The grant agreement on the part of the Government of the Republic of Tajikistan was signed by the Minister of Economic Development and Trade Nematullo Hikmatullozoda, and on the part of the Asian Development Bank, the ADB Country Director for Tajikistan Pradeep Srivastava”, — the source noted.
The agreement will contribute to the development of Tajikistan’s energy sector.
